It's no secret that Pokemon TCG has been plagued by scalpers for a long time now, to the point where some fans never get the chance to purchase some of the new or most popular items, or even sets as a whole. The fight against scalping has taken many forms over time, such as limiting the number of booster packs and products each customer can purchase.
Not only that, but some of the best moves in each set also end up on sale at eye-popping prices due to the huge demand and, again, scalpers. An example is how the incredibly rare and popular SIR (secret illustration rare) of Umbreon from Pokemon TCG The Prismatic Evolutions set sold for over $3,000 at launch. At launch, Pokemon TCGThe Prismatic Evolutions set sold out very quickly, forcing The Pokémon Company to release a statement expediting reprints to bring it back as quickly as possible. The reprints helped, but they weren't enough. As an example, after all this time, the ETB is still going for well over $200, when its MSRP was just $49.99 when it came out.
The price on Amazon is still far from MSRP, but considering the average market price for this item, it's still a very good deal. It's worth noting that this isn't the Pokemon Center variant, which includes two more booster packs for a total of 11 compared to the original's nine. Newer sets don't have it any easier though.
